Following the emotional return captured in ‘Live in London’ , Akram continues his journey with ‘Live at Greenbelt’ a bold and electrifying live album recorded during his iconic Greenbelt Festival appearance (Summer 2024). This release marks another milestone in a year filled with musical rebirth, connection, and reflection.
Where ‘Live in London’ was a homecoming, ‘Live in Greenbelt’ is a moment of reflection, a raw and soul-stirring set shaped by the weight of the times and the urgency of expression. Performing to a diverse and open-hearted crowd, Akram delivers a powerful set that blends his signature sound with fresh interpretations, spontaneous improvisation, and a deep sense of purpose.
The album features the world-class lineup from Live in London Elliot Galvin on keys, Riley Stone-Lonergan on saxophone, Mirko Scarcia on electric bass, and Per Anders Skytt on drums. Their chemistry is unmistakable, and together they carry the music with depth, precision, and emotional force. The group revisits material from Abu Kenda alongside beloved older tracks, offering an unfiltered, high-energy glimpse into the evolving live sound of Akram’s work.
